Are you passionate about the therapeutic power of the outdoors? Key Enterprises is looking for an energetic and adaptable Adventure Facilitator to lead our service users on new journeys. Whether it is paddle-boarding and forest school skills or maintaining our bicycle fleet and heading out on rides, you will help adults with learning disabilities, autism, and other mental health needs step out of their comfort zones, improve their physical health, and tackle isolation. If you have an infectious enthusiasm for nature and the outdoors with a commitment to inclusive support, we want to help you build a program that plays to your strengths that also achieves outcomes for our service users.

This is a full-time role for 5 days a week (Monday – Friday 08:30 – 16:30) but we are open to flexible working arrangements or a part time position if you are the right person for the job.

Please take a look at our social media to see what we’ve been up to recently, you can follow us on Instagram @keyenterprises83 or search us on Facebook.

Essential Criteria:

Expectations of the facilitator includes a range of the below skills (but is not limited to these either and we’d work with the successful facilitator in developing a program that suits their strengths).

  • To facilitate outdoor adventure activities using Key Enterprises in Benton, North Tyneside as a base with the goal of achieving outcomes and promoting wellbeing through outdoor pursuits.
  • Competent in the instruction of physical exercises
  • Experience of supporting adults with additional needs and the different approaches to communication, engagement and activities that maximise benefit
  • To run activities that are accessible to a range of abilities and co-ordinate volunteers to support.
  • To be able to motivate service users to take on new challenges (ranging from learning to ride a bike, engaging with exercise for the first time to bigger adventures in the outdoors such as rock climbing, overnight camps and longer hikes/walks/expeditions)
  • To maintain and service a small fleet of bicycles
  • A knowledge of areas in the North East that would be suitable for outdoor pursuits including hikes, nature walks, camping and bike rides. We’re in close proximity to Newcastle upon Tyne, Whitley Bay, Tynemouth, Gosforth and wider areas around Northumberland, South Tyneside and County Durham.
  • Can facilitate activities along our coastline including such activities as paddle boarding, kayaking, and doing cold water dips.
  • A knowledge of nature and wildlife and an infectious enthusiasm that can be shared with service users for getting into nature
  • Adaptability for times of inclement weather to keep our service users entertained and engaged with indoor activities in our dedicated space.
  • Comfortable driving a van/minibus
  • Take advantage of the latest technology to support the role both internally and in reaching out to stakeholders within the community (smart device use, location sharing, using GPS, planning sessions using Microsoft Office packages and communicating comprehensively through Microsoft Outlook and Teams.
  • Knowledge in engaging with health and safety procedures and policy including writing risk assessments for activities.
